Easy Almond Cupcakes (With Almond Buttercream)

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 large egg (room temperature)
  • 1/4 cup oil
  • 1/2 cup plant-based sour cream (full fat, room temperature)
  • 1/2 cup water (room temperature)
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1/41/2 tsp almond extract (adjust to taste)
  • 1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our (sifted)
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1/2 tsp baking soda
  • 2 cups almond buttercream frosting

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350 degrees F.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the egg, oil, plant-based sour cream, water, vanilla extract, and almond extract until smooth.
  3. In a separate bowl, combine the sifted flour, sugar, baking powder, and baking soda. Gradually add this dry mixture to the wet ingredients until just combined.
  4. Pour the batter into cupcake liners in a muffin tin, filling each liner about two-thirds full.
  5. Bake for 18-20 minutes or until a toothpick inserted comes out clean.
  6. Allow cupcakes to cool completely before frosting with almond buttercream.
